Please forward this mail to the rcs(1) maintainer: A while back OSF QAR 06389 was written for the "date -u" command because it caused RCS to break. The specific reason was because the Time Zone string returned by date(1) command was set to "CUT" and RCS wanted to see the string "GMT". I am not quite sure what impact this had on rcs(1) and the ODE II build environment. The sidecar project: ie I18N DEC OSF/1 V1.2, utilizes the I18N technologies based on the XPG4. This again caused the Time Zone string to change to "UTC". Will this once again cause rcs(1) to break? Sterling will include I18N/XPG4 DEC OSF/1 V1.2 commands. All commands used to build the system will be integrated by June 10. Again, I am not quite sure what impact this will have on rcs(1) and the ODE II build environment. It is very important that we get the build commands integrated successfully and that we are able to build using ODE II with the new V1.2 commands.
